site stats

Mysql group by limit each group

WebSep 24, 2024 · @Googlebot it doesn't work unles rank column is unique.DENSE_RANK() value is not unique. If you want to limit rows included, not distinct rank, then you must expand sorting criteria which must provide rows uniqueness.Or alternatively you may agree to obtain indefinite row from possible duplicates by rank.For this you must replace … WebThe GROUP BY statement is often used with aggregate functions ( COUNT (), MAX (), MIN (), SUM (), AVG ()) to group the result-set by one or more columns. GROUP BY Syntax SELECT column_name (s) FROM table_name WHERE condition GROUP BY column_name (s) ORDER BY column_name (s); Demo Database

12.20.3 MySQL Handling of GROUP BY

WebOct 21, 2024 · MySQLです。 グループごとにorder by、limitを掛けたレコードを取得したいのですが、いまいち方法が分かりません。 レコードの中でgroup by して、各グループごとにある値が最大値であるレコードだけを持ってきたテーブルが作成したいです。 例:商品マスタに以下のようなテーブルがあった時、 種類 番号 名前 フルーツ 1 りんご フルー … WebTo get records with max value for each group of grouped MySQL SQL results, you can use a subquery to first determine the maximum value for each group, and then join the subquery … the advantages are https://barmaniaeventos.com

mysql - Why do we use Group by 1 and Group by 1,2,3 in SQL query …

Web1 Answer. Sorted by: 3. You can separate the problem into multiple steps. First lets create an example table: SQL Fiddle. MySQL 5.5.32 Schema … WebFeb 28, 2024 · The GROUPING SETS option gives you the ability to combine multiple GROUP BY clauses into one GROUP BY clause. The results are the equivalent of UNION ALL of the specified groups. For example, GROUP BY ROLLUP (Country, Region) and GROUP BY GROUPING SETS ( ROLLUP (Country, Region) ) return the same results. WebJun 3, 2024 · Sometimes you may need to get first row in each group or min row per group. Here’s how to get first record in each group in MySQL. You can also use this SQL query to get top 1 row in each group in MySQL, PostgreSQL, SQL Server & Oracle. You can use it to select top 1 row for each group. How to Get First Record in Each Group in MySQL the french door bridal boutique

12.20.3 MySQL Handling of GROUP BY

Category:MySQL MAX Function - Find the Maximum Value in a Set

Tags:Mysql group by limit each group

Mysql group by limit each group

Limit the count using GROUP BY in MySQL - TutorialsPoint

WebMar 21, 2016 · Plan C: INDEX (x) and GROUP BY x. In this case, the optimizer may choose to use the index as a way to avoid the 'sort'. Furthermore if you have LIMIT 1, it only needs to …

Mysql group by limit each group

Did you know?

WebJun 15, 2024 · What is the meaning of the GROUP BY clause in MySQL? GROUP BY is one of the most useful MySQL clauses. It groups rows with the same values into summary rows. … http://charlesnagy.info/it/postgresql/group-by-limit-per-group-in-postgresql

WebThe MySQL GROUP BY Statement. The GROUP BY statement groups rows that have the same values into summary rows, like "find the number of customers in each country". The … WebMay 13, 2024 · GROUP BY GROUP BY is more difficult to explain. For example, we can group the returned results. select Continent, Name, max(GNP) from country group by Continent; select Continent, Name, max (GNP) from country group by Continent; COPY Output: HAVING HAVING is to look for eligible conditions.

WebMySQL evaluates the HAVING clause after the FROM, WHERE, SELECT and GROUP BY clauses and before ORDER BY, and LIMIT clauses: Note that the SQL standard specifies that the HAVING is evaluated before SELECT clause and after GROUP BY clause. MySQL HAVING clause examples Let’s take some examples of using the HAVING clause to see … Webmysql> CREATE TABLE mytable ( -> id INT UNSIGNED NOT NULL PRIMARY KEY, -> a VARCHAR (10), -> b INT -> ); mysql> INSERT INTO mytable -> VALUES (1, 'abc', 1000), -> (2, 'abc', 2000), -> (3, 'def', 4000); mysql> SET SESSION sql_mode = sys.list_add (@@session.sql_mode, 'ONLY_FULL_GROUP_BY'); mysql> SELECT a, SUM (b) FROM …

WebJan 26, 2015 · or alternatively, group by in both tables and then union all. In this case, you'll need another group by in a derived table but it will probably be more efficient, mainly because you can change the grouping by a calculated column ( CountryCode + ProductNumber + StockType) to become GROUP BY CountryCode, ProductNumber, …

WebSep 24, 2024 · mysql - LIMIT the number of rows in GROUP BY and GROUP_CONCAT with ORDER - Database Administrators Stack Exchange LIMIT the number of rows in GROUP BY and GROUP_CONCAT with ORDER Ask Question Asked 1 year, 6 months ago Modified 1 year, 6 months ago Viewed 2k times 1 In this sqlfiddle, the french duck wolverhamptonWebJun 29, 2013 · What I want is to get the count for each answer for a specific question ID, but limit it to the n first answers each month. ... Retrieving the last record in each group - MySQL. 506. Using LIMIT within GROUP BY to get N results per group? 1468. Using group … the french door sioux falls sdWebApr 12, 2024 · MySQL is a popular, free-to-use, and open-source relational database management system (RDBMS) developed by Oracle. As with other relational systems, MySQL stores data using tables and rows,... the french east india company was founded inWebMySQL GROUP BY Count is a MySQL query that is responsible to show the grouping of rows on the basis of column values along with the aggregate function Count. Basically, the GROUP BY clause forms a cluster of rows into a type of summary table rows using the table column value or any expression. the advantages cloud computingWebWITH ROLLUP queries, to test whether NULL values in the result represent super-aggregate values, the GROUPING () function is available for use in the select list, HAVING clause, and … the advantages jackson msWebDec 19, 2014 · MySQL allows you to do GROUP BY with aliases ( Problems with Column Aliases ). This would be far better that doing GROUP BY with numbers. Some people still teach it Some have column number in SQL diagrams. One line says: Sorts the result by the given column number, or by an expression. the french east india company was dissolvedWebOct 8, 2010 · MySQL GROUP BY but limit to top 2 per group. Databases. johnsmith153 October 8, 2010, ... You should read it all, but your answer lies under “Select the top N … the advantages of advertising